Proposed Planned Development Ordinance Amendment

The Planning Commission recommended approval of an amendment to the planned development provisions of the Zoning Ordinance at their June 5th Meeting. The Planning Commission's recommendation has been forwarded to the Board of Mayor and Aldermen for consideration.

A Board of Mayor and Aldermen public hearing regarding the planned development amendment was held on July 14, 2008. Third reading is scheduled for the Board of Mayor and Aldermen's July 28, 2008 Meeting. The meeting will start at 6:00 PM in the Town Hall Board Chambers. Town Hall is located at 500 Poplar View Parkway.

If approved after the third reading, the amendment will be adopted.

Subdivision Regulations

The following copy of the Subdivision Regulations incorporates revisions approved by the Planning Commission on May 8, 2008. The amendment applies to all new subdivision applications submitted for the September Planning Commission Meeting (applications submitted on or after July 9, 2008).
